Metaphorically speaking, an operations manager resembles a conductor orchestrating a grand symphony—ensuring every instrument plays its part properly and at the right time so that the entire orchestra creates a harmonious sound or, in this case, a successful organization. Operations management encompasses anything from taking care of financials to ensuring the delivery of a company's services promptly and under budget. A professional catering operations manager serves as an important asset to any organization willing to improve its back-office activity and enhance its general efficiency.
As catering operations manager, you perform a vital role in ensuring the frictionless management of daily operations and achieving a synchronised approach to back-end business processes. The responsibilities of catering operations manager differ depending on industry and company type. Nevertheless, they often involve tasks associated with planning, arranging and coordinating, and executing operational activities.

Automation in operations management delegates routine and repetitive tasks to technology. Consider the data entry process: utilizing a tool like airSlate for automatic data entry can replace hours of manual work. This leads to improved time efficiency, minimized error number, and an overall boost in operational output. Behind this technology can be anything from Robotic Process Automation (RPA) to Machine Discovering (ML) or even Artificial Intelligence (AI).
